Whiny Wednesday: J.R. Martinez & Diana Gonzalez-Jones Share Their Nursery
I was recently sent photos of J.R. Martinez and partner Diana Gonzalez-Jones’ beautiful nursery. Are you gasping yet? I sure do love the romantic elegance of this room; it has such a peaceful feel to it just by looking at it (although I’m sure there are times it’s not so peaceful, ha).
The couple selected Oilo‘s freesia bedding (a soft blush tone with a contrasting floral print and a herringbone patterned sheet; a three-piece set is $399), and Oilo glider and pouf (recommended retail is $1,349 for the glider and $349 for the pouf), along with a coordinating diaper change pad and topper. And I don’t know about you, but I’m really digging the design of the square crib! I love everything to have symmetry and this nursery totally does.
“We absolutely love our Oilo glider! It’s one of our favorite pieces in the room and has such a unique cool design that is actually very comfortable. Coupled with the very pretty design of our Oilo Freesia bedding, both are standout pieces that truly make our dream nursery extra amazing!” — J. R. Martinez and Diana Gonzales-Jones
The couple also used a Naturalmat Coco organic mattress (the company also carries organic mattresses for children’s bed, and I must investigate; I kick myself a million times for not investing in an organic mattress for little C. as a baby or child).
“It’s important to us to help protect the environment and that of our daughter’s well-being. When it came to choosing a comfortable crib mattress that met our needs, Naturalmat was the perfect choice.”
Oh, and those cute little gold shoes in the bottom photo? They’re pediped Originals, natch. (Sorta wishing they came in adult sizes…blush…)
